Transaction 8585e27cf7508bddf40708745c0efb5016f934af36c4d511235be730c9e77a30
1 Input
1 Output
-
8585e27cf7508bddf40708745c0efb5016f934af36c4d511235be730c9e77a30:0
- value
- 2983642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8017efedad587614e71d77408df516ecf2d4bde OP_EQUAL
- address
- 3KvYrrn4ctiK8CxbaE5HpwqrHonmURFKDH